Rosenxt is a forward-thinking technology group — we are visionary architects of progress with 45 years of engineering excellence. Our expertise across sensors, autonomous robotics, AI, and advanced materials, combined with a strong R&D mindset, enables us to develop highly innovative products and services for customers operating in the most challenging environments, including subsea, industrial, renewables, and the integrity of water and energy supply.

We are seeking a technically hands-on Workgroup Lead to lead our Robotics Software team in Bristol. This role offers the opportunity to shape a growing organization’s technological direction while managing a talented, cross-disciplinary group of engineers specializing in robotic systems engineering, perception systems, sensor data processing, behavior planning, and robotic control towards product readiness.

As the local leadership anchor within a distributed international organization, you will collaborate closely with teams across the United Kingdom and continental Europe. You will enjoy high autonomy, direct impact, and a clear path to influence Rosenxt’s robotics innovation strategy.

Key Responsibilities

  • People Leadership
    • Lead and develop a high-performing team of robotics, software engineers and further specialists, primarily based in Bristol.
    • Conduct one-on-one meetings, define performance goals, and oversee career development.
    • Foster an inclusive, transparent, and results-oriented team culture grounded in trust and collaboration.
    • Promote a learning-driven environment aligned with Rosenxt’s values of innovation and technical excellence.
  • Delivery and Execution
    • Oversee planning, development, and delivery of software and product components, ensuring milestones are achieved on schedule.
    • Implement and maintain best practices for software quality, data processing, testing, and documentation.
    • Identify process inefficiencies and lead structured improvements to enhance delivery performance.
  • Cross-Organizational Collaboration
    • Partner with internal Robotics Software, Controls, and Systems Engineering teams across the Rosenxt network to integrate advanced robotic solutions.
    • Ensure communication and coordination between R&D teams in the UK and Germany.
    • Align local activities with Rosenxt’s global technology roadmap and product strategy.
  • Technical Engagement
    • Contribute actively to projects, technical discussions on robotics topics, including perception algorithms, sensor calibration, decision-making, motion planning, and control systems.
    • Provide architectural insight and ensure alignment with Rosenxt’s broader technology framework.
    • Stay current with emerging research and industrial developments in robotics and AI technologies.

What you bring

Required Qualifications

  • 5+ years of professional experience in developing product-ready robotic systems, including perception, control with focus on software development.
  • Proven experience in technical leadership or early-stage engineering management roles.
  • Expertise in one or more areas: robotics technologies, computer vision, SLAM, or sensor fusion.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and collaboration skills within distributed, cross-functional teams.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Robotics,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or a related field.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Master’s or Ph.D. in Robotics, Computer Vision, or related discipline.
  • Experience deploying robotic systems in real-world applications or industrial automation.
  • Understanding of safety-critical domains (e.g., subsea engineering, energy, defence).
  • Knowledge of regulatory or compliance frameworks (EU Acts, ISO standards).
